解决方案 »

  1.   

    网页么 可以试试webbrowser
    webBrowser1.Document.All["wchan"].SetAttribute("value", comboBox1.Items[1].ToString());
      

  2.   

    这个html在哪里,IE里吗不要告诉我html在服务器上
      

  3.   

    我记得以前有人问过这个问题,是你吗?
    我还举例说明过网站天生是个通信程序,只谈服务端是没有任何意义的,数据要发送给客户端让人看,人操作完了把结果提交回去,这才是有意义的行为好比你从网上下载电影,资源在服务器上,你下载到自己电脑里,这个过程是有意义的而你现在想要问:我不去动服务器,就想把电影给改了.
    电影在哪呢?
    你好歹先下载到本地才能改吧,否则是直接改服务器上的文件吗?
    而只改下载后的文件,对原来的文件没有任何影响,对其他人再去下载文件也不造成任何影响,根本就是无意义的行为.html也一样,它必须在IE里呈现.
    你抛开服务器和其他用户,单独说要改html,根本是无意义的行为
      

  4.   

    那么需要先确定你这个文本框到底在哪里,是自己做的webbrowser里,还是在IE里,处理方法是不同的
    如果是webbrowser里,参考2楼的代码,你需要先知道html里文本框的ID是什么,然后给它赋值
    如果是IE里,就很难办了,这涉及到进程通信,而且相当于进程劫持,因为IE本身没有提供这个接口,你是相当于要做一个病毒或木马或流氓插件不说清楚需求是很难办的
    好比你说不去月亮上,怎么让月亮变成红色的
    那就要说清楚是在哪看月亮使它看起来像是红色的,是在某个大楼里,还是在街上,是你自己看起来是红的,还是让所有其他人看起来也都是红的?
    如果只是自己看起来是红的,戴个红色的墨镜就行了
      

  5.   

    遍历html节点~~~找到相应的文本框,然后给该文本框赋值~~~